How long is the PCT period for Bulgarian invention patent application

Submitted by 页之码 on
  • via Paris Convention : 12 months from earliest priority date.
  • via Nationalization of PCT : 31 months from earliest priority date.
  • Validation of European Patent in EPO member states: 3 months from the date of European patent grant
